There are several options for getting from Capri to Palermo by ferry, train, bus and plane. The cheapest option is to take a ferry and then take the bus which costs around €52 ($52) and will take around 12h 25m. If you need to get there more quickly, you can take a ferry and then fly and arrive in approximately 2h 50m, though it is a bit more costly at approximately €95 ($95).

Yes there is a ferry service that runs between Capri and Palermo. The ferry typically takes around 11h 15m and departs once daily.
Navigazione Libera del Golfo, SNAV, Tirrenia and Grandi Navi Veloci run the ferry services between Capri and Palermo. Ferries run once daily and take around 11h 15m on average but will vary depending on conditions and travel date.
It doesn't look like you can fly directly from Capri to Palermo. We recommend that you take a ferry to Naples then fly from Naples (NAP) to Palermo (PMO). instead which will take 2h 50m.
The closest major airport to Palermo is Falcone–Borsellino Airport (PMO) (PMO) which is approximately 23km (14 miles) from Palermo. Trapani-Birgi Airport (TPS) (TPS) and Comiso Airport (CIY) (CIY) are also nearby and might be a better alternative airport depending on where you are flying from.
